### Runbook: user-module split, release 12.4

Deploy user-svc before the Marwick monolith build; ordering matters. Verify health endpoint returns ready, then flip USER_SPLIT_ENABLED=true in the monolith env. Rollback is the reverse: flag off, then retire user-svc. Both sides must share the same handshake credential or all session calls 401. In the env file, add that credential on the line below:

secret setting of tawif-tajop: COURIER_KEY13=819c65d82d2bd

ALERT: Splitgate assignment service returned deterministic bucket IDs for 12% of requests over the past hour, suggesting the salt rotation job failed. Experiment assignments may be predictable, enabling bucket manipulation. Service remains up; integrity is the concern, not availability. Review the rotation audit trail and sign-off checklist on the page below.

wiki page, tageg-kagap: https://rundeck.tolvaqhq.example/settings/merge_requests/issue/build/ticket/run/ticket/b43dbdf7e2bdd679fb7f087a

### Seat-Map Renderer: Stalled Tiles

Applies to the Velvetine renderer used by the Orpheon Hall box office. Symptom: grey tiles where seat blocks should render. First check the layout cache service; a stale manifest is the usual cause. Flush the cache, then reload one venue to confirm. Never flush during an active on-sale. If tiles stay grey, escalate to the Stagecraft team. Full diagnostic flow is on the internal page below.

runbook for badug-kadup: https://confluence.zemvarlabs.internal/projects/browse/display/projects/bd1b

Subject: Handover — Trailform offline sync store (security review)

Hi,

Handing over the Trailform field-survey offline subsystem ahead of your review. Offline mode writes survey batches to an encrypted local queue; on reconnect, batches upload to the sync store and are validated against schema version before merge. Audit logging covers every merge decision. Access is restricted to the sync role, which has no DDL rights. The sync store is reached via the connection string below.

replica DSN, kajep-yahag: mssql://praok_svc:iF@db-8d68.plorvaio.local:5432/eliion